ANDERSEN v. CROUSE

85-9263; A38555.

730 P.2d 1275 (1986)

83 Or.App. 216

In the matter of the Adoption of Jimmy Lee Crouse; a Minor. Joyce Eilene ANDERSEN and Garry Wesley Andersen, Respondents, v. Johnny Lee CROUSE,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Oregon.

Decided December 31, 1986.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jeffrey A. Long, Certified Law Student, Salem, argued the cause for appellant. Stefanie Woodward, Inmate Legal Services, Inc., Salem, filed the brief.

No appearance for respondents.

Before WARDEN, P.J., and VAN HOOMISSEN and YOUNG, JJ.


VAN HOOMISSEN, Judge.

This is an action terminating a non-custodial father's parental rights under ORS 109.3221 and allowing the adoption of his minor child. Father appeals, contending that the trial court erred in ordering his waiver of consent to the adoption without first allowing him to present his defense in opposition to the adoption. We review de novo. ORS 19.125(3).
